Tre Dita: A Tuscan Culinary Gem in Chicago's St Regis Hotel District.
Nestled within the luxurious St Regis Hotel at 401 E Wacker Dr, Chicago, Tre Dita offers an exceptional Italian dining experience that transports food lovers to the heart of Tuscany. Known for its authentic Tuscan cuisine, this Italian restaurant is a top destination for those craving handmade pastas, wood-fired steaks, and a menu that bursts with rich, vibrant flavors inspired by Italy’s culinary traditions.

Savor the Flavors: Signature Dishes and Drinks
Indulge in a menu that boasts rich, flavorful pastas like Cacio e Pepe and Tagliatelle Al Ragù, perfectly complemented by standout mains such as the 60-day dry-aged A5 Kagoshima Kuroushi New York Strip and expertly cooked swordfish. The kitchen’s skill shines in every dish, highlighting freshness and authentic ingredients. For beverage lovers, Tre Dita offers an extensive wine list featuring rare Barolos and other fine selections, alongside expertly crafted cocktails and a creative mocktail menu to suit all tastes.

Practical Tips for Planning Your Visit
- Reservations Reservations can be made through OpenTable, with availability typically opening seven days in advance.
- Dress Code The dress code is casual elegant, so smart casual attire is recommended.
- Gluten-Free Options While there isn't a dedicated gluten-free menu, the staff is knowledgeable and can accommodate gluten-free requests upon inquiry.
